K. Anbalagan is a scholar working on Water Science and Technology, Organic Chemistry and Industrial and Manufacturing Engineering. According to data from OpenAlex, K. Anbalagan has authored 20 papers receiving a total of 386 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Water Science and Technology, 5 papers in Organic Chemistry and 5 papers in Industrial and Manufacturing Engineering. Recurrent topics in K. Anbalagan's work include Adsorption and biosorption for pollutant removal (9 papers), Effects and risks of endocrine disrupting chemicals (4 papers) and Nanomaterials for catalytic reactions (3 papers). K. Anbalagan is often cited by papers focused on Adsorption and biosorption for pollutant removal (9 papers), Effects and risks of endocrine disrupting chemicals (4 papers) and Nanomaterials for catalytic reactions (3 papers). K. Anbalagan collaborates with scholars based in India. K. Anbalagan's co-authors include G. Karthikeyan, R. Karthikeyan, P. Senthil Kumar, K. Ilango, R. Mohankumar, S. Prabhakar, Mathur Rajesh, Saman Hameed, Appunni Sowmya and M. Sindhuja and has published in prestigious journals such as Journal of Cleaner Production, Industrial Crops and Products and Journal of Photochemistry and Photobiology A Chemistry.
